This PR is a patch for Modular TensorFlow Graph C API.
It removes global GrapplerItemMap. Optimizer API has changed from
void (*optimize_func)(void*, TF_Buffer*, TF_Buffer*, TF_Status*);tovoid (*optimize_func)(void*, const TF_Buffer*, const TF_GrapplerItem*, TF_Buffer*, TF_Status*);
